Cracked cats would be most likely the factor of A) cheap design and crappy welds (kinetix cats), B) The fact that many aftermarket cats do not retain the factory brace that bolts to the bottom of the transmission, and C) A low exhaust on a lowered car that was bottomed out violently in the past. It has nothing to do with the design of the "cat back" exhaust.

Fed Ex dropped it off last night..
The box came in last night. Fed ex was dicking me around for a few days, as they were trying to deliver when I was at work, and they would'nt let me come pick it up. When the box did come, it looked like they ran it over a few times with a fork lift. ALso a nice hole ripped in the side of the box. Nothing fell out. The setup was otherwise packed pretty well. the box was thick and reinforced with straps, and everything was wrapped up with lots of bubble wrap and tape. The only damage was a little scratch on the burnt part of the tip, and a small dent on the canister towards the h-pipe. I called them up and told them how it looked and they are sending me new tips, and I told them that the dent was allright... Not worth shipping it back and playing the waiting game again. Sooo other than that, lets get into the first impression. I inspected each piece with a close eye on every weld and seam. It all looked very solid and well put together. I'm not sure of the exact gauge of the ss piping, but it is pretty heavy stuff. The surface is nicely polished to a chrome finish. The hangers are strong and welded very secure. The flanges are 1/4" thick, heavy steel and all the angles line up perfectly. (the exhaust is laid out and bolted together on my livingroom floor). Well, I gotta run for now, and there's not much more I can say about the appearence, but I will take pics tonight and get some good closeups. Look for them tomorow. It will be installed next week.
